A Redundancy Removal Data Collection Approach Based on Mobile Sink for Heterogeneous Sensor Networks is proposed which is using both the mobile sink approach and redundancy removal mechanism. In redundancy removal mechanism, the sensor nodes will sense the data and send it to the cluster head for the first time, but after that if the sensed data is same i.e. within the specified interval of time, then the nodes will send only the difference between the previously sent data and the current sensed data. If the sensed data is out of the specified range or interval , then node will send the complete data again. The proposed work reduces the number of bits to be transmitted over the network which decreases the energy consumption and hence increases network lifetime.
